Transaction ad68b62023731f39b74f4bbc7a8a4473989dd95092b648441cd35b24aec28a0e

block
1ab22b1a10211638f91d9e34b0e76128d75511c9eadfb0c0e98a700fed256e2f

1 Input

4 Outputs